Sonic Reducer Overage: Mixmaster Mike, Los Amigos Invisibles, Wu-Tang Clan, Morning Benders, and more
2008-12-03 07:22:44 by Kimberly Chun in SFBG: Noise
 


Say hello to my little invisible friend: Los Amigos Invisibles' "Cuchi Cuchi."

Ask and the city provides - good times and solid sounds for all. Here's the good schtuff that didn't make it to print.

WU-TANG CLAN
The Wu is with you - though RZA and Ghostface Killah were MIA when the group last played Ess Ef. Wed/3, 8 p.m., $45. Grand Ballroom at Regency Center, Van Ness and Sutter, SF. (415) 421-8497.

LOS AMIGOS INVISIBLES
This year the Venezuela group impressed at Outside Lands and threw out its first live DVD - and a new studio album is said to be in post-production. With Funky-C and DJ Felina. Thurs/4, 9 p.m., $22. Independent, 628 Divisadero, SF. (415) 771-1421.

MIXMASTER MIKE
The Invisibl Skratz Pikl and Beastie Boy cohort cuts up for Club Six's 10th anniversary. Fri/5, 10 p.m., $15 advance. Club Six, 60 Sixth St., SF. (415) 863-1221.



MORNING BENDERS

Anytime is the right time for the sweet indie-poppers. Fri/5, 8:30 p.m., $12. Rickshaw Stop, 155 Fell, SF. (415) 861-2011.


Grog city: Mike Relm's "Everytime."

MIKE RELM AND PEANUT BUTTER WOLF
It's been too long since PBW was back in town. And real-time VJ sets - well, awright, that's what Relm does so well. With DJ Party Ben. Fri/5. Mezzanine, 444 Jessie, SF. (415) 820-9669.

BARCELONA
Dreamy Anglicized indie emanates from the Seattle band. With LoveLikeFire and Low vs. Diamond. Sat/6. 9 p.m., $14. Independent, 628 Divisadero, SF. (415) 771-1421.


JOE STRUMMER TRIBUTE

The Armagideons (with Black Furies' Cliff Truesdell), Eric McFadden, the Hooks, RubberSideDown, Dead Ringers, and the Ferocious Few raise a ruckus at this benefit for Strummervlle. Sun/7, 7 p.m., $10. Bottom of the Hill, 1233 17th St., SF. (415) 621-4455.

JONATHAN RICHMAN
The local icon awed us with just an acoustic guitar and drums the last time he appeared at the Music Hall. Sun/7, 8 p.m., $15. Great American Music Hall, 859 O’Farrell, SF. (415) 885-0750.

MESHELL NDEGEOCELLO AND THE COUP
MN: Free as a bird and briefly roosting in her former hometown. Sun/7, 8 p.m., $29.50. Fillmore, 1805 Geary, SF. (415) 346-6000.

JILL TRACY
Expect spooky songcraft from the SF original. With the Holy Kiss, Murder of Lilies, and DJ Nako. Sun/7, 9 p.m., $10. Cafe du Nord, 2170 Market, SF. (415) 861-5016.
